From simhash import simhash
WebMar 3, 2024 · Simhash算法可以用来计算每行文本之间的相似度。具体步骤如下: 1. 对于每行文本,使用Simhash算法生成一个长度为n的二进制哈希值。其中n是哈希值的长度,一般取64位或128位。 2. 对于两行文本,可以通过计算它们的Simhash值之间的海明距离来判断它们的相似度。 WebUse the Simhash Index Use the SimhashIndex to query near duplicates objects in a very efficient way. import re from simhash import Simhash, SimhashIndex def …
From simhash import simhash
Did you know?
WebSimhash is a state-of-art method to assign a bit-string fingerprint to a document, such that similar documents have similar fingerprints. Finding the near-duplicates in a large collection of documents consists of two stages: (a) compute the simhash fingerprint of each document, and (b) find pairs of similar fingerprints by ... WebAug 2, 2024 · package main import ( "fmt" "github.com/safeie/simhash" ) func main () { s1 := simhash.Simhash ("this is a project for golang implementation of simhash …
WebExample 2. def test_chinese( self): self. maxDiff = None sh1 = Simhash( u '你好 世界!. 呼噜。. ') sh2 = Simhash( u '你好,世界 呼噜') sh4 = Simhash( u 'How are you? I Am … http://benwhitmore.altervista.org/simhash-and-solving-the-hamming-distance-problem-explained/
WebJan 31, 2024 · Package simhash provides a simple hashmap implementation and related interfaces, ... Go to latest Published: Jan 31, 2024 License: Apache-2.0 Imports: 2 … WebAug 2, 2024 · Details. Valid go.mod file The Go module system was introduced in Go 1.11 and is the official dependency management solution for Go.
WebAug 6, 2024 · A simhash is a single sequence of bits (usually 64 bits) generated from a set of features in such a way that changing a small fraction of those features will cause the resulting hash to change only a small fraction of its bits; whereas changing all features will cause the resulting hash to look completely different (roughly half its bits will …
WebAug 15, 2024 · SimHashTransformer, applying the SimHash algorithm to a document vectorization as part of a scikit-learn pipeline. Finally, there is a third class available: SortingSimHash, which performs the SortingLSH … i\\u0027m howling at the moonWebMar 2, 2024 · GitHub - 1e0ng/simhash: A Python Implementation of Simhash Algorithm. master. 2 branches 0 tags. Code. 1e0ng Bump version. 78f3b8d on Mar 2, 2024. 138 … i\\u0027m human and i need to be lovedWebMar 2, 2024 · simhash 2.1.2. pip install simhash. Copy PIP instructions. Latest version. Released: Mar 2, 2024. A Python implementation of Simhash Algorithm. netsh to show wifi passwordWebPython SimhashIndex.get_near_dups - 16 examples found. These are the top rated real world Python examples of simhash.SimhashIndex.get_near_dups extracted from open source projects. You can rate examples to help us improve the quality of examples. Programming Language: Python Namespace/Package Name: simhash Class/Type: … i\\u0027m hudson he\\u0027s hicksWebsimhash is a Python library typically used in Utilities, Download Utils applications. simhash has no bugs, it has no vulnerabilities, it has build file available, it has a Permissive License and it has low support. You can install using 'pip install simhash' or download it from GitHub, PyPI. A Python Implementation of Simhash Algorithm Support netsh trace filemodeWebMar 31, 2011 · simhash. Charikar similarity is most useful for creating 'fingerprints' of documents or metadata so you can quickly find duplicates or cluster items. ... >> > from hashes.simhash import simhash >> > hash1 = simhash(' This is a test string one. ') >> > hash2 = simhash(' This is a test string TWO. ') >> > hash1 < simhash.simhash object … netsh trace captureWebIn computer science, SimHash is a technique for quickly estimating how similar two sets are. The algorithm is used by the Google Crawler to find near duplicate pages. ... import collections: import jieba: from jieba import analyse # TODO: Change default hash algorithms to the other algorithms of high-performance. def _default_hashfunc(content ... netsh trace filter by ip